Problem:
Jacob purchased a water plant. While testing, he found that in 1 ml of water, a particular salt content was 0.0078 grams. Find the salt content in 1 ltr of water.
Solution:
Salt content in 1 mil of water = 0.0078 g.
Salt content in 1000 ml of water = 0.0078(1000)
= 7.8 g.
